Irving-owned railway pleads not guilty to safety violations in oil transport

SAINT JOHN, N.B. — A railway owned by New Brunswick’s Irving family has pleaded not guilty to 24 charges alleging the company violated safety standards in the way it transported oil. Gaming giant known for Assassin’s Creed, Far Cry sets up shop in Winnipeg

WINNIPEG — A world-renowned video game company is setting up shop in Winnipeg. Ubisoft, which is known for games like Assassin’s Creed and Far Cry, says it is opening an office in the city. Facebook says it should have audited Cambridge Analytica

NEW YORK — Facebook’s No. 2 executive says the company should have conducted an audit after learning that a political consultancy improperly accessed user data nearly three years ago. Recalls this week: space heaters, toy sets

Vornado space heaters are being recalled this week because a certain model can potentially overheat while in use, posing a fire hazard. Other recalled consumer products include toy sets with a battery component that can overheat.
